Clogged Drain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or clog in a single drain | Yes | No | You can likely clear the clog with a plunger or drain snake. |
| Backed-up toilet or sink | No | Yes | A professional is needed to diagnose and fix the issue quickly. |
| Standing water or significant flooding | No | Yes | A professional is needed to remove the water and prevent further damage. |
| Unpleasant odors or foul smells | No | Yes | A professional is needed to diagnose and fix the issue quickly. |
| Slow drains or gurgling sounds | No | Yes | A professional is needed to diagnose and fix the issue quickly. |
| Water damage or stains on your ceiling or walls | No | Yes | A professional is needed to remove the water and prevent further damage. |

Clogged Drain Water Removal Cost in Winder, GA
The cost of clogged drain water removal in Winder, GA can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of the situation and may not include more costs for repairs or replacements. Get a free estimate today and find out how much you can save with our expert services.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| Water Removal and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, type of equipment needed |
| Drying and Disinfection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| More Repairs or Replacements | $500 – $5,000 | Severity of the issue, type of repairs or replacements needed |
